The Unexpected Benefits of Play, with Dr. Tina Payne Bryson
Discover how life's frustrations can actually become opportunities for growth. Dr. Tina Bryson shares how play expands our "window of tolerance," allowing us to work through challenges with more ease and resilience.
Psychotherapist and author Dr. Tina Bryson invites us to open-hearted and empathic perspective taking, and seeking an integrated wholeness that incorporates all of who we are—highlighting the gift of play in our most intimate relationships and family life.
In this conversation with Tina Bryson, we discuss:
- The importance of play for all ages, especially as a counterbalance to stress, and its role in expanding our window of tolerance.
- The difference between free unstructured play and dyadic, relational play, with a focus on child-led play for fostering connection and brain integration in children.
- How play helps individuals, particularly children, process emotions and develop emotional flexibility by safely trying on different experiences and feelings.
- Practical ways to incorporate playfulness into daily life and relationships, emphasizing that even small moments of shared delight can build significant connections.
- And insights into Tina's new book, "The Way of Play," which provides seven strategies for parents to engage in child-led play to help integrate children's brains and strengthen family relationships.
